Esther Helene (Recks) Van Walk
July 3, 1918 – November 11, 1993
Esther Van Walk, 75, passed away Thurs., Nov. 11, 1993 in Tacoma, Washington.
She was born in Perry, Oklahoma on July 3, 1918, she was the daughter of Frederick and Julianna R. Koehler Recks. Her parents died when she was very young. Following her graduation from Perry high in 1935, she attended Draughon’s business college in Oklahoma City. In August, 1936 she moved with other family members to Tacoma, Washington. She joined the Zion Lutheran Church became active in the Walther League, the official youth group. James Roland Van Walk, another member of the Walther League, caught her eye. They were married on June 7, 1941.
For many years she enjoyed working as the secretary at Spanaway Lutheran Church, and most recently at Good Shepherd Lutheran Church where she and her husband Jim were charter members since the early 50’s. Esther will be remembered as an active member of the Lutheran church, who always was involved in helping others and freely giving her time to those who needed her.
She was preceded in death by her loving husband of 47 years, James R. Van Walk.
Survivors include: daughters, Jeanne Robertson, Point Richmond, CA, Linda Nelson Avery, Bellevue, WA, Julie Storaasli and her husband, Mark, Puyallup; son, D.A. Van Walk and his wife, Joanne. She is also survived by 4 grandchildren, many nieces, nephews and friends.
